Inclusion Criteria:
* Willing and able to consent to the study
* Agree to comply with requirements and procedures
* Veteran who has served in a branch of the US armed forces
* Between ages 18-60
* Report using cannabis within the past three years but not more than twice in the past month
* Exposure to Criterion A stressor defined by CAPS-5 and identified by Life Events Checklist-5 (LEC-5); trauma does not have to be related to combat or military service
* Significant PTSD severity as indicated by CAPS-5 diagnosis and/or score \>= 25 of at least one month prior to study entry, PTSD is patient's primary concern
* not currently receiving any psychotherapy for PTSD
Exclusion Criteria:
* Pregnant, lactating or are a heterosexually active, pre-menopausal woman who is NOT using medically approved birth control (e.g., oral or depot contraception, contraceptive implant, IUD, condom/foam, sterilization, tubal ligation)
* Current or past diagnosis of any bipolar or related disorder or schizophrenia spectrum and other psychotic disorder as determined by the SCID-5 or previous diagnosis by a licensed psychologist or psychiatrist
* Determined to be at high risk for suicide requiring immediate intervention based on the C-SSRS and/or clinician judgment
* Meet criteria for substance use disorder other than Cannabis Use Disorder or Alcohol (Mild or Moderate) or Nicotine Use Disorder, determined by the SCID-5
* Presence of contraindications, current or past allergic or adverse reaction, or known sensitivity to smoking cannabis
* Concomitant treatment with medication taken daily that has level 1 evidence indicating severe drug-drug interactions with cannabis
* Currently receiving psychotherapy for PTSD or previously received exposure-based PTSD treatment
* Current diagnosis or evidence of significant or uncontrolled hematological, endocrine, cerebrovascular, cardiovascular, systemic, pulmonary, pulmonary fibrosis, or other forms of restrictive lung disease, immunocompromising, or neurological disease
* Current diagnosis of a mood, anxiety, or other disorder that is more clinically salient than PTSD
* Cognitive exhibit impairment
* Lack of fluency in English
* Insufficient memory of the index traumatic event
* Pervasive development disorder history
* Seeking or currently undergoing treatment for Cannabis Use Disorder.
* Traumatic brain injury (TBI) with current cognitive impairment related to TBI
* Exclusively left-handed (score of -100 on Handedness Questionnaire)
* claustrophobic
* MRI contraindications (e.g., ferrous metal in head/body)
